best AI chatbots for websites

Best AI Chatbots for Websites: The Complete Guide for Business Owners

A visitor lands on your website with a question. It is 11pm on a Sunday. No one is there to answer. They leave. The sale — or the lead, or the booking — is gone. This is happening on your website right now. Every day. Every night. Every hour you are not online.

An AI chatbot changes that. Not the simple FAQ bots that frustrate users with rigid menus and scripted responses — but genuinely intelligent conversational AI that understands natural language, answers questions accurately, qualifies leads, books appointments, handles support, and escalates to a human only when it actually needs to.

The technology has crossed a threshold. Today’s best AI chatbots are trained on your specific content, integrate with your CRM and helpdesk, speak dozens of languages, and deliver a customer experience that a growing number of users prefer over waiting for a human response.

This guide covers every major AI chatbot platform for websites — compared honestly by features, pricing, and the use case each one actually excels at.

What Makes an AI Chatbot Different from a Regular Chatbot

Not all chatbots are created equal. Before comparing platforms, understand the difference between what the market offers:

Type How It Works Quality of Experience
Rule-based / menu bot Pre-scripted decision trees — user picks from options Frustrating — users must fit their question into your categories
Keyword-triggered bot Matches keywords in user messages to canned responses Limited — fails on anything slightly different from the keyword
AI-powered NLP chatbot Understands natural language — responds to any phrasing of a question Good — handles variation, understands intent
LLM-powered chatbot (GPT-4/Claude) Trained on your content, uses large language models to generate accurate, contextual answers Excellent — feels like talking to a knowledgeable human

The platforms in this guide all use AI and NLP at minimum. The best ones use GPT-4 or similar large language models trained specifically on your website content — giving answers that are accurate, contextual, and genuinely useful.


What to Look for When Choosing a Website AI Chatbot

Factor Why It Matters
Training on your content A chatbot that learns from your FAQ, product pages, and docs answers accurately — a generic bot gives generic answers
Live chat handoff When AI cannot handle something, seamless handoff to a human agent is essential
CRM and helpdesk integration Connects with your existing tools — Hubspot, Salesforce, Shopify, WooCommerce
Platform compatibility Works on WordPress, Shopify, Wix, Webflow, or embeds via code snippet
Lead capture Can collect name, email, and phone before answering — turns conversations into contacts
Multilingual support Responds in the visitor’s language automatically
Analytics Conversation data, resolution rates, handoff rates — tells you how the bot is performing
Pricing model Per seat, per conversation, per contact — know what you are paying for as you scale

The Best AI Chatbots for Websites — Full Reviews


1. Tidio (tidio.com)

Best overall for small to medium businesses — best free plan available.

Tidio is the most popular AI chatbot for small business websites, with over 300,000 businesses using it. It combines an AI chatbot (powered by their Lyro AI model, built on Claude) with live chat in one seamless platform — so the bot handles what it can and your team handles the rest.

Key features:

  • Lyro AI — conversational AI trained on your FAQ content, answers up to 70% of queries automatically
  • Live chat integration — smooth handoff between AI and human agents
  • Proactive triggers — bot initiates conversations based on page, time on site, exit intent
  • Visual chatbot builder — create custom flows with drag-and-drop
  • E-commerce integrations — Shopify and WooCommerce native plugins, shows order status in chat
  • Email and Messenger integration — manage all channels from one dashboard
  • Visitor tracking — see who is on your site in real time

Platform support: WordPress, Shopify, Wix, Squarespace, BigCommerce, custom HTML embed

Free plan: Yes — Lyro AI handles 50 conversations/month free. Live chat unlimited on free plan.

Pricing: Free plan available. Starter from $29/month. Growth from $59/month.

Ideal for: Small businesses, e-commerce stores, service businesses, WordPress and WooCommerce sites.

Limitation: Lyro AI conversation limit on lower plans — heavy usage requires the Growth plan.


2. Crisp (crisp.chat)

Best for startups and SaaS — clean UI, generous free plan, powerful all-in-one inbox.

Crisp is a customer messaging platform that combines AI chatbot, live chat, email, and a helpdesk in one unified inbox. Its free plan is one of the most generous in the market — two seats and unlimited conversations at no cost.

Key features:

  • AI chatbot with knowledge base training
  • Shared inbox — all messages (chat, email, Messenger, WhatsApp, Instagram) in one place
  • MagicBrowse — see exactly what the visitor is doing on your site in real time during a chat
  • Chatbot automation builder — visual flow designer
  • CRM built in — contact profiles, conversation history, notes
  • Co-browsing — share screen with visitors to assist directly
  • Campaign messaging — proactively message segments of your user base

Platform support: WordPress plugin, Shopify, any website via JavaScript snippet

Free plan: Yes — 2 seats, unlimited conversations, basic chatbot.

Pricing: Free plan. Pro from $25/month per workspace. Unlimited from $95/month.

Ideal for: SaaS companies, startups, tech businesses wanting an all-in-one customer messaging platform with a strong free entry point.

Limitation: AI chatbot features are more basic than Tidio’s Lyro or Intercom’s Fin on lower plans.


3. Intercom (intercom.com)

Best for growing businesses — the most powerful AI chatbot platform available.

Intercom’s Fin AI Agent is built on GPT-4 and is widely considered the most capable AI chatbot for business websites. It resolves complex customer queries that simpler bots cannot handle, integrates deeply with your product data, and delivers resolution rates of 40-60% without any human intervention.

Key features:

  • Fin AI Agent — GPT-4 powered, trained on your help content, resolves complex queries
  • Omnichannel — web chat, email, WhatsApp, SMS, social from one platform
  • Product tours — onboard new users with guided in-app walkthroughs
  • AI Insights — analyses conversation data to identify your most common issues automatically
  • Customer segmentation — target messages by user attributes, behaviour, and plan
  • Ticketing system — full helpdesk built in
  • Deep integrations — Salesforce, HubSpot, Stripe, Shopify, 400+ apps

Platform support: Any website via JavaScript, Shopify, WordPress, native mobile SDK

Free plan: No. 14-day free trial.

Pricing: Starter from $39/month. Fin AI Agent charged at $0.99 per resolution (only pay when it actually resolves a query).

Ideal for: Growing businesses, SaaS companies, e-commerce stores with significant support volume, companies wanting the highest AI resolution rate.

Limitation: More expensive than alternatives — best suited to businesses where support costs justify the investment.


4. Chatbase (chatbase.co)

Best for building a custom GPT-4 chatbot trained entirely on your own content — in minutes.

Chatbase lets you upload your documents, paste your website URL, or connect your knowledge base — and it builds a custom GPT-4 powered chatbot trained specifically on that content. No coding, no complex setup. You can embed it on your website in under 30 minutes.

Key features:

  • Train on website URL, PDFs, Word docs, Notion pages, Google Docs
  • GPT-4 powered responses — answers questions based only on your content
  • Custom persona — set the bot’s name, tone, and personality
  • Lead collection — capture name and email before or during conversation
  • Conversation history — full log of all chat interactions
  • API access — connect to any platform or workflow
  • Human escalation — route to live agent when needed
  • Supports 80+ languages

Platform support: Embed on any website via iframe or chat bubble script. WordPress, Shopify, Wix compatible.

Free plan: Yes — 1 chatbot, 30 message credits/month, 400,000 characters of training data.

Pricing: Free plan. Hobby from $19/month. Standard from $49/month.

Ideal for: Small businesses, freelancers, agencies building client chatbots, anyone who wants a custom AI chatbot without technical complexity.

Limitation: Less of a full customer platform — focused on chatbot only, no live chat team features on lower plans.


5. CustomGPT (customgpt.ai)

Best for businesses that need a deeply accurate chatbot with strict content boundaries.

CustomGPT builds a GPT-4 powered chatbot from your business content and is specifically designed to stay within the boundaries of what you have trained it on — it will not hallucinate or go off-topic. Ideal for professional services, legal, medical, and financial businesses where accuracy is non-negotiable.

Key features:

  • Ingests website, PDFs, sitemaps, YouTube videos, and API data
  • Strict content boundaries — only answers based on your uploaded content
  • Anti-hallucination mode — declines to answer if information is not in its knowledge base
  • Citations — shows which source document it used for each answer
  • GDPR compliant — data stored in EU data centres on request
  • White-label — fully brandable for agencies

Platform support: Embed on any website via script. WordPress compatible.

Free plan: No. Free trial available.

Pricing: Basic from $49/month. Standard from $99/month.

Ideal for: Law firms, medical practices, financial advisors, professional services, regulated industries where accuracy and accountability are critical.

Limitation: More expensive than Chatbase for similar functionality. Best value for professional services and regulated businesses.

6. Freshchat (freshworks.com/live-chat-software)

Best for businesses needing chatbot plus full omnichannel customer support.

Freshchat is part of the Freshworks suite — a family of business tools including CRM, helpdesk, and ITSM. Its AI chatbot integrates tightly with the rest of the suite, making it ideal for businesses already using Freshdesk or Freshsales.

Key features:

  • Freddy AI — AI chatbot trained on your knowledge base and FAQs
  • Omnichannel inbox — web chat, WhatsApp, Instagram, Apple Business Chat, email
  • Bot builder — visual flow designer for complex conversation paths
  • Auto-resolve — Freddy AI can close resolved conversations automatically
  • Agent assist — AI suggests replies to human agents in real time
  • Integration with Freshdesk (helpdesk) and Freshsales (CRM) natively

Platform support: WordPress, Shopify, any website via JavaScript snippet

Free plan: Yes — unlimited agents, limited bot sessions.

Pricing: Free plan. Growth from $19/agent/month. Pro from $49/agent/month.

Ideal for: Businesses already in the Freshworks ecosystem, call centres, support teams wanting deep helpdesk integration.

Limitation: Per-agent pricing becomes expensive for larger teams.


7. HubSpot Chatbot Builder (hubspot.com)

Best for businesses using HubSpot CRM — seamless native integration.

HubSpot’s chatbot builder is built directly into the HubSpot CRM platform. Every conversation is automatically logged against a contact record — so your sales team has full context on every lead the chatbot has talked to.

Key features:

  • Native CRM integration — every chat contact and conversation saved to HubSpot automatically
  • Lead qualification bot — qualifies leads with custom questions and routes to the right sales rep
  • Meeting booking — chatbot books demos and calls directly into the sales team’s calendar
  • Knowledge base bot — answers support questions from your HubSpot knowledge base
  • Customisable flows — visual bot builder with conditional logic
  • Free for all HubSpot users including free CRM

Platform support: HubSpot pages, WordPress (via plugin), any website via HubSpot embed code

Free plan: Yes — chatbot builder is free with HubSpot CRM.

Pricing: Free with HubSpot CRM free plan. Advanced AI features require Marketing or Service Hub.

Ideal for: Businesses using HubSpot CRM, inbound marketing teams, sales-led businesses wanting automatic lead capture and qualification.

Limitation: AI capabilities are less advanced than Intercom or Tidio — better for structured lead flows than open-ended customer support.


8. Drift (drift.com)

Best for B2B companies — pipeline-focused conversational marketing.

Drift pioneered the concept of conversational marketing — using chatbots not just for support but as a primary sales channel. Its AI is built specifically for B2B sales, qualifying visitors, routing them to the right sales rep, and booking meetings automatically.

Key features:

  • AI Sales Assistant — qualifies visitors, identifies high-intent buyers, routes to reps
  • Fastlane — automatically fast-tracks known buyers and key accounts to instant meeting booking
  • Intent data — integrates with 6sense and Demandbase to identify and prioritise target accounts
  • ABM integration — personalises chatbot experience for target companies
  • Video messaging — sales reps can record short video intros embedded in chat
  • Salesforce and HubSpot native integration

Platform support: Any website via JavaScript. Salesforce and Marketo native connectors.

Free plan: No.

Pricing: Premium from $2,500/year. Enterprise pricing on request.

Ideal for: B2B SaaS companies, enterprise sales teams, demand generation marketers with significant inbound volume.

Limitation: Expensive — designed for enterprise B2B, not small businesses or e-commerce.


9. Voiceflow (voiceflow.com)

Best for building completely custom AI chatbot experiences — no limits on what you can create.

Voiceflow is a professional platform for designing and deploying AI agents. Unlike the other tools on this list which are primarily SaaS products with pre-built features, Voiceflow is a build tool — you design every conversation flow, integrate any AI model, and connect any data source.

Key features:

  • Visual conversation designer — build any chat or voice experience with drag and drop
  • Multi-LLM support — connect GPT-4, Claude, Gemini, or any custom model
  • Knowledge base integration — connect to any data source for RAG-powered responses
  • API integrations — connect to any external system at any step in the conversation
  • Multi-channel — deploy the same agent to web chat, WhatsApp, Alexa, and more
  • Collaboration — team-based design and version control

Platform support: Embed on any website. Deploy to any channel via API.

Free plan: Yes — collaborative workspace with 2 agents.

Pricing: Free plan. Pro from $50/month. Teams from $625/month.

Ideal for: Agencies building client chatbots, developers wanting full control, businesses with complex multi-step conversational requirements.

Limitation: Steeper learning curve than plug-and-play tools — not ideal for non-technical users wanting a quick setup.


10. Shopify Inbox (shopify.com/inbox)

Best for Shopify stores — completely free, deeply integrated, surprisingly capable.

Shopify Inbox is a free live chat and AI chatbot tool built directly into the Shopify platform. For any Shopify merchant, it should be the first chatbot installed — it is free, requires no third-party integration, and already knows your products, orders, and inventory.

Key features:

  • Free — completely free for all Shopify merchants
  • Product sharing — send product links and images directly in chat
  • Order status — bot automatically answers “where is my order?” using real order data
  • AI-generated reply suggestions — suggests replies based on conversation context
  • Instant answers — configure automatic responses to common questions (shipping, returns, hours)
  • Automated abandoned checkout messages — re-engage customers who left without buying
  • Mobile app — manage all conversations from your phone

Platform support: Shopify only.

Free plan: Completely free.

Ideal for: Every Shopify merchant — install this before considering any paid chatbot tool.

Limitation: Shopify only. AI capabilities are less advanced than dedicated AI chatbot platforms — best as a starting point before upgrading to Tidio or Gorgias.


Best AI Chatbots by Platform

WordPress

Best choice: Tidio — native WordPress plugin, easiest setup, best AI for the price. Runner up: Crisp — generous free plan, clean UI, good for service businesses. For custom GPT chatbot: Chatbase — embed via script, train on your WordPress content.

Shopify

Start here (free): Shopify Inbox — install first, it is free and already knows your products. Scale to: Tidio — best Shopify AI chatbot for growing stores. For high-volume support: Gorgias (gorgias.com) — the top helpdesk and chatbot for high-volume Shopify stores.

Wix / Squarespace / Webflow

Best choice: Chatbase or Crisp — both embed via code snippet on any platform. Runner up: Tidio — JavaScript embed works on any site builder.

Any Platform (Custom Code Embed)

Best choice: Intercom (most powerful), Chatbase (easiest custom GPT), or Voiceflow (most customisable).


Side-by-Side Comparison: All 10 AI Chatbots

Platform Free Plan Starting Price AI Model Best For
Tidio Yes (50 AI conversations) $29/mo Claude (Lyro AI) Small business, e-commerce
Crisp Yes (2 seats, unlimited) $25/mo NLP + AI Startups, SaaS, generous free
Intercom No (trial) $39/mo + $0.99/resolution GPT-4 (Fin) Growing businesses, high volume
Chatbase Yes (1 bot, 30 credits) $19/mo GPT-4 Custom content chatbot, quick setup
CustomGPT No (trial) $49/mo GPT-4 Professional services, accuracy-critical
Freshchat Yes (limited bots) $19/agent/mo Freddy AI Freshworks ecosystem users
HubSpot Chatbot Yes (free with CRM) Free Rule-based + AI HubSpot CRM users, lead generation
Drift No $2,500/yr Proprietary AI B2B enterprise sales
Voiceflow Yes (2 agents) $50/mo Multi-LLM Agencies, developers, custom builds
Shopify Inbox Completely free Free AI suggestions Every Shopify store

Step-by-Step: Setting Up Your First AI Chatbot on WordPress

Using Tidio as the example — the most recommended starting point for WordPress sites:

Step 1 — Install Tidio

  1. Go to WordPress Admin → Plugins → Add New
  2. Search “Tidio”
  3. Install and Activate

Step 2 — Create Your Tidio Account

  1. Click “Set Up Tidio” in your WordPress dashboard
  2. Create a free account at tidio.com
  3. Your site is automatically connected

Step 3 — Train Lyro AI on Your Content

  1. In Tidio dashboard → Lyro AI → Knowledge Base
  2. Click “Add Source” → paste your FAQ page URL
  3. Add your Returns/Refund policy page URL
  4. Add your Services or Products page URL
  5. Lyro crawls and learns all pages automatically
  6. Test by asking it your 10 most common customer questions

Step 4 — Set Up Proactive Triggers

  1. Go to Automation → Add Automation
  2. Create trigger: “Visitor on site for 30 seconds” → Bot says “Hi! Can I help you find anything?”
  3. Create trigger: “Visitor on checkout page for 2 minutes” → Bot says “Any questions before you complete your order?”
  4. Create trigger: “Exit intent detected” → Bot offers a discount or asks why they are leaving

Step 5 — Configure Human Handoff

  1. Set your operating hours in Tidio → Settings → Business Hours
  2. During hours: bot handles queries, escalates to you via live chat notification
  3. Outside hours: bot collects email and name, sends notification for next-day follow-up
  4. Always allow “talk to a human” as an option in every conversation

Step 6 — Go Live and Monitor

  1. Check the chat widget appears on your site
  2. Test the chatbot from a private browser window
  3. Monitor the Analytics tab for resolution rate and most common queries
  4. Update your knowledge base monthly as your FAQ evolves

What AI Chatbots Cannot Do (Yet)

Setting honest expectations matters. The best AI chatbots are impressive — but they have real limits:

  • Complex emotional situations — a customer calling to complain about a serious problem deserves a human. AI can de-escalate, but genuinely upset customers should be handed off quickly.
  • Highly specific or technical queries — if your product requires deep technical knowledge, the AI will only be as good as the content you have trained it on. Gaps in your knowledge base become gaps in the chatbot.
  • Accurate information outside its training — if your pricing changes and you do not update the knowledge base, the bot will give wrong prices. Knowledge base maintenance is an ongoing responsibility.
  • Replacing human sales on high-value deals — AI chatbots close small transactions and qualify leads. Closing a $50,000 contract still needs a human.

The Bottom Line

The question is no longer whether your website needs an AI chatbot. The gap between sites with 24/7 intelligent chat and sites with nothing is too large, and growing.

Visitors expect answers instantly. AI chatbots deliver them — at 3am, in any language, at a cost that makes round-the-clock human support impossible to justify at the same scale.

For WordPress and WooCommerce sites: start with Tidio. For Shopify: start with Shopify Inbox. For custom GPT on any site: start with Chatbase.

All three have free plans. All three can be set up in under an hour. All three will change how your website handles conversations from the moment they go live.

Install one this week. Train it on your content. Measure the difference in 30 days.

Similar Posts

Leave a Reply

Your email address will not be published. Required fields are marked *